是否可以在无接口导入的函数调用中运行函数?如果我正在导入库,作为示例,每次调用其函数foo时,我的函数,条,也会被称为? 感谢
答案 0 :(得分:0)
如果您可以修改代码并且foo
所在的班级不是最终版,则您可以覆盖班级的foo
以呼叫bar
:
class MyFooClass extends FooClass{
@Override
void foo(){
bar(); //Not sure if you want bar to be static or not, or if you want bar first or last.
super.foo();
}
}
然后只需在代码中使用MyFooClass
代替FooClass
。